Microgyne is a genus of flowering plants belonging to the family Asteraceae.[1]
Its native range is Uruguay to Argentina.[1]
Species
Species:[1]
- Microgyne marchesiana Bonif. & G.Sancho
- Microgyne trifurcata Less.
